Question 2:
A right triangle whose sides are 3 cm and 4 cm (other than hypotenuse) is made to revolve about its hypotenuse. Find the volume and surface area of the double cone so formed. (Choose value of π as found appropriate.)
Answer:
The double cone so formed by revolving this right-angled triangle ABC about its hypotenuse is shown in the figure.
Surface area of double cone = Surface area of cone 1 + Surface area of cone 2
= πrl1 + πrl2
= πr [4 + 3] = 3.14 × 2.4 × 7 = 52.75 cm2
